The road to freedom for victims of kidnapping is often long and arduous. However, with the support of loved ones, authorities, and advocacy groups, it is possible for survivors to rebuild their lives. Counseling, therapy, and medical treatment can help victims to overcome the trauma of their experiences, while also providing them with the tools to regain control over their lives. brutal violence the kidnapping free
